Output 595451bfeffc92bd395f13c30f2a7b48c5be9a972b46e45f21cd915dcec09e8b:0

value
1002307
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fea6fb4e4954b1175fda19a54013df64ed8d3e05 OP_EQUAL
address
3QuVbMiiaLpxSHLuTr7jdoucVAYq7K4vcX
transaction
595451bfeffc92bd395f13c30f2a7b48c5be9a972b46e45f21cd915dcec09e8b
confirmations
387124
spent
true